There is no diary here, so to speak. Several members have created threads of their own that are their quit diaries that they post to everytime they log in. Others, like me, have created quit diaries in Word and copy/paste good posts and inspirational quotes to it and also write in it everyday, or every once in a while. Both are good options if you want a quit diary. Hope that helps! Crave the Quit!
